Episode description

Along a cold and isolated riverside, deep in the primeval forest, a small team of adventurers makes an emergency landing at a rotting and waterlogged village to repair their leaking boat. Little do they know that, deep within a nearby temple-tomb, a wretched, forgotten god-thing from centuries long past seeks to make its return amidst rituals of plague and suffering. Will our trapped adventurers defeat the god-thing once and for all, or will they too be stolen away to perform the Rites of Weeping?

Characters include Professor Oston Misthill, halfling academic; Lennart Turnip-Warden, cleric and protector of all things earthen and turnip; and Nixell Metgard, fearless dwarven leader.

This is the first of two sessions of Old-School Essentials, using the folk horror adventure "Rites of Weeping" by Harry Menear. For more on Old-School Essentials, check out necroticgnome.com. Rites of Weeping can be purchased at https://preview.drivethrurpg.com/en/product/409267/Rites-of-Weeping.
